POS Description Length ----------------------------------------------------------------- : 1 : A-Z : 1 : :-------:------------------------------------------------:------: : 2 : : : : 3 : : : : 4 : Record Date : 6 : : 5 : : : : 6 : : : : 7 : : : :-------:------------------------------------------------:------: : 8 : Filler : 1 : :-------:------------------------------------------------:------: : 9 : : : : 10 : Time of Call : : : 11 : : 5 : : 12 : (Hour:Minute) : : : 13 : : : :-------:------------------------------------------------: : : 14 : Filler : 1 : :-------:------------------------------------------------:------: : 15 : : : : 16 : : : : 17 : Duration Of The Call : : : 18 : : : : 19 : Not in hours. : 8 : : 20 : (Minutes:Seconds) : : : 21 : Example:2 hours=120 minutes : : : 22 : : : :-------:------------------------------------------------:------: : 23 : Filler : 1 : :-------:------------------------------------------------:------: : 24 : : Orginating : : : 25 : : NPA : 3 : : 26 : : : : :-------: :----------------: : : 27 : Orginating : Orginating : : : 28 : Number : NXX : 3 : : 29 : : : : :-------: :----------------: : : 30 : : : : : 31 : : Originating : 4 : : 32 : : Line : : : 33 : : : : :-------:------------------------------------------------: : : 34 : Filler : 1 : :-------:------------------------------------------------:------: : 35 : : : : 36 : Call Code : 3 : : 37 : : : :-------:------------------------------------------------:------: : 38 : Filler : 1 : :-------:------------------------------------------------:------: : 39 : Call Type : 1 : :-------:------------------------------------------------:------: : 40 : Dial Indicator : 1 : ----------------------------------------------------------------- : 41 : Filler/WATS Band : 1 : :-------:------------------------------------------------:------: : 42 : : Filler : 1 : :-------: :--------------:------: : 43 : : : : : 44 : : Term-NPA : 3 : : 45 : : : : :-------: :--------------:------: : 46 : : : : : 47 : : Term-NXX : 3 : : 48 : : : : :-------: :--------------: : : 49 : : : : : 50 : : : : : 51 : : Term-Line : 4 : : 52 : Dialed Digits : : : :-------: (Up to 24) :--------------:------: : 53 : (Left Justified) : : : : 54 : : : : : 55 : : Term-Line : 4 : : 56 : : Expanded : : :-------: :--------------:------: : 57 : : Filler : 1 : :-------: :--------------:------: : 58 : : Carrier : : : 59 : : ID : 3 : : 60 : : : : :-------: :--------------:------: : 61 : : : : : 62 : : : : : 63 : : Filler : 5 : : 64 : : : : : 65 : : : : :-------:------------------------------------------------:------: : 66 : Filler : 1 : :-------:------------------------------------------------:------: : 67 : : : : 68 : : : : 69 : : : : 70 : : : : 71 : Account/CDAR Codes : : : 72 : (Up to 14 digits) : 14 : : 73 : : : : 74 : : : : 75 : : : : 76 : : : : 77 : : : : 78 : : : : 79 : : : : 80 : : : :--------------------------------------------------------:------: Glossary: Call Codes: This is a list of the call codes that maybe in a call detail report with a brief explanation: 001 Detailied Message Rate, Timed: also (Call code 005) Recorded for a local message rate or a measured service call. The call is timed and includeds both orginating and terminating numbers. 002 Message Rate, Timed: Recorded for a local message rate call or a measured service call. This call code is used for calls that do not require full call details for billing. 003 Detailed Message Rate, Untimed: Recorded for a local message rate call,like the latter. But it is not timed and gives both orginating and terminating numbers. 004 Message Rate, Untimed: Recorded for a local message rate call. It also does not require full details or timing for billing. The call is not timed and also like the timed code it does not reveal the terminati 006 Station Paid: This code provides full details for a direct dial station paid toll call. 007 WATS Station Identification: This code provides identification of the calling station on a call routed over a WATS facility. The full business day and the WATS band information are included. 008 INWATS Terminating Entry: This is recorded for a INWATS call terminating at an 800 Service line. "Terminating Entry" refers to the proclines pa<2> says: generating AMA data for incoming calls at the called point. The Orginating number field of this record contains the terminating number. 009 Directory Assistance (1)411: This call code is for the DA service only. 010 Station Paid Operator Assisted: Records in OSS for all operator handled stating paid calls as well as ACTS, Time and Charges, and Notify calls. 011 FX/Automatic Flexible Routing (AFR): This is recorded for a call that was initiated as an FX call but was routed via AFR to another service. Details recorded will show the type of call that the AFR routed to. 012 Common Control Switching Arrangement, AFR to WATS: This is recorded for a call that was initaited as a CCSA call but was routed to a wATS kube. The details recorded are more-or-less WATS. 016 Person Paid: Recorded when a person-to-person call is billed to the orginating number. 021 CCSA: Recorded for calls routed through CCSA. 024 DDD, Operator Assisted: Recorded on an operator assised toll call in order to cause billing at DDD rates. It is necessary in special cases, such as when the operator assisted because of reported troubles. Routing troubles are rare. 030 WATS AFR to WATS: Indicates that a WATS call was blocked on the orginal trunk and was routed to an alternate trunk. 032 Tandem Tie Trunk: Recorded for trunk calls placed over tie trunks. 033 Directory Assistance (long distance, 555-1212) Recorded for calls to home NPA directory assistance. 044 Emergency Interrupt-Paid: Records for a Emergency interrupt call to be billed to the orginator. 069 WATS AFR to DDD & CCSA AFR to DDD (070): Indicates that call was initiated as WATS but routed to the DDD network. The details recorded are toll. 083 Inward Call Exteneded to a Centrex Station: Recorded for inward calls extended to a Centrex station. It allo 0 for a terminating access code of from one to five digits. 084 Inward Call Extended to a Tie Trunk: Recorded for inward calls extended to a Tie Trunk. It allows for a terminating access code of from one to five digits. 085 Electronic Tandem Switch: Recorded for a electric tandem switched call routed over normal ETS trunks. 099 Electronic Tandem Switch Call via CCSA: Recorded for a electronic tandem switch call routed over a private CCSA private network. 110 InterLATA Station Paid: Recorded for direct dialed station paid toll calls routed via an inter- exchange carrier. The record contians carrier information for applying access charges. 111 InterLATA WATS Station Detail: Recorded fo WATS call routed ca interexchange carrier and identifies the calling station. The record contians carrier information for applying access charges. 124 CDAR Local And Untimed Message Rate: Recorded for local non-billable and untimed message rate call utilizing the CDAR feature. Call types: 0-Completed 1-Attempt 2-Long Duration 3-International Dial Indicators: 1-Direct Dialed 2-Operator Handled 3-ETS/FX 4-CCSA 5-Directory WATS Bands: Valid WATS Bands range from 0-7 (0 indicated non WATS Call Codes) Acronyms: CCSA: Common Control Switching Arrangement ACTS: Automatic Coin Telephone Service Band: This refers to a trunk. WATS: Is a connection between a customers's end user's premises and a LEC (Local exchange carrier) end office switch capable of performing the necessary screening functions for 800 service.
